Time of Update: 2015-06-22
標籤:mysql命令列中執行多行命令時,如果前邊輸入的命令發生錯誤,是無法返回修改的,但是可以通過輸入\c來取消前邊的輸入,但是這時如果前邊輸入的東西很多,直接取消又很可惜的話,可以通過\p來列印出前邊的命令,複製下來去修改,然後輸入\c取消來重新輸入命令。Example12345678910111213mysql> select 8 from a -> where
Time of Update: 2015-06-22
標籤: 程式設計語言選擇php5 , web伺服器選擇Apache2 ,後台資料庫選擇MySQL首先安裝編譯工具, 開啟終端sudo apt-get install build-essential autoconf automake1.9 cvs subversion (不管你裝沒裝過都試一下)Apache 的安裝sudo apt-get install apache5PHP5的安裝sudo apt-get install php5php5環境的MYsql的安裝sudo
Time of Update: 2015-06-22
標籤:本文通過一個簡單的執行個體完成了完整的PHP+MySQL會員系統功能。是非常實用的一個應用。具體實現步驟如下:一、會員系統的原理: 登陸-->判斷-->保持狀態(Cookie或Session)-->驗證狀態及其許可權二、會員系統的安全:1、學會使用常量提高md5安全性2、Cookie/ Session 少用明文資訊3、Session安全性要大於Cookie4、使用Cookie/ Session讀取資訊 盡量增加判斷資訊5、Cookie/
Time of Update: 2015-06-22
標籤: 首先說明下問題的情況, 1、我storm 環境已經搭建完成,在本地測試wordcount是沒問題的, 2、我在wordcount中加入一個MysqlBolt,此Bolt只是簡單的把 wordcount的結果存入mysql資料庫中,在本地模式測試測試時,完全可以把結果插入指定表。 3、我的每個storm-節點都已經把mysql-connector-java-5.1.23.jar 放到storm的lib目錄下。 4、每個節點均可以訪問指定資料庫,都已經開通相應許可權 5、
Time of Update: 2015-06-22
標籤:<?php/** * 產生mysql資料字典 */// 設定資料庫$database = array();$database[‘DB_HOST‘] = ‘127.0.0.1‘;$database[‘DB_NAME‘] = ‘cqhshop‘;$database[‘DB_USER‘] = ‘root‘;$database[‘DB_PWD‘] = ‘123456‘; $mysql_conn = @mysql_connect("{$database[‘DB_HOST‘]}",
Time of Update: 2015-06-22
標籤:預存程序預存程序的建立許可權和使用許可權是分開的。建立預存程序前先用DELIMITER // 將分隔字元改為// 最後再DELIMITER ; 改回來。用 drop procedure *;刪除預存程序,更好的方法是 drop procedure * if
Time of Update: 2015-06-22
標籤:1. 一個簡單的例子1.1. 建立表: create table t(s1 integer);1.2. 觸發器:delimiter |create trigger t_trigger before insert on t for each row begin set @x = "hello trigger"; set NEW.s1 = 55;end; |1.3.
Time of Update: 2015-06-22
標籤:一、數學函數ABS(x) 返回x的絕對值BIN(x) 返回x的二進位(OCT返回八進位,HEX返回十六進位)CEILING(x) 返回大於x的最小整數值EXP(x) 傳回值e(自然對數的底)的x次方FLOOR(x) 返回小於x的最大整數值GREATEST(x1,x2,...,xn)返回集合中最大的值LEAST(x1,x2,...,xn)
Time of Update: 2015-06-22
標籤:編寫C語言程式connect1.c與MySQL資料庫建立串連,在命令列輸入:gcc connect1.c -o connect1.exe -I/usr/include/mysql -L/usr/lib/mysql -lmysqlclient顯示找不到mysql.h,如下(圖1)所示:原因是安裝MySQL時只是安裝了MySQL的伺服器和MySQL的用戶端,沒有安裝MySQL database development files.解決辦法:1.圖形介面操作:直接在軟體中心輸入MySQL
Time of Update: 2015-06-23
標籤:高可用 主從複製 mmm 讀寫分離 mariadb 前言MMM(Master-Master replication managerfor Mysql,Mysql主主複製管理器)是一套靈活的指令碼程式,基於perl實現,用來對mysql replication進行監控和故障遷移,並能管理mysql
Time of Update: 2015-06-23
標籤:mysql myisam 列名 修改 欄位名 如果需要更改某一列的的預設值屬性如:ALTER TABLE USER MODIFY COLUMN NAME VARCHAR(64) DEFAULT ‘DEFAULT_USER‘;這樣會導致整個表被鎖,所有的行都更新完畢鎖資源才會釋放。這種情況下可以使用這種命令ALTER
Time of Update: 2015-06-23
標籤:mysql sql 拼sql 例子如下:CREATE TEMPORARY TABLE NEW_TIME_CLIENT(UUID VARCHAR(36), CLIENT_MAC VARCHAR(17), ONLINE_SECONDS INT)ENGINE=MEMORY;SET @SQL_NEW_TIME_CLIENT=CONCAT("INSERT INTO
Time of Update: 2015-06-23
標籤:如果在一台機子上起多個MySQL執行個體, 比如連接埠號碼為 3306, 3307, 3308登入時候要選擇不同的 mysql.sock檔案mysql -uroot -p123456 這一句 登入的是 3306的執行個體 mysql -uroot -p123456 -S /home/mysql_3307/mysql.sock 這一句 登入的是 3307的執行個體這時候 用 -P 3307 這個選項是不管用的。 這個-P 的選項和 -h
Time of Update: 2015-06-23
標籤:什麼是blob,mysql blob大小配置介紹 字型:[增加 減小] 類型:轉載 BLOB (binary large object),二進位大對象,是一個可以儲存二進位檔案的容器。在電腦中,BLOB常常是資料庫中用來儲存二進位檔案的欄位類型 BLOB是一個大檔案,典型的BLOB是一張圖片或一個音效檔,由於它們的尺寸,必須使用特殊的方式來處理(例如:上傳、下載或者存放到一個資料庫)。根據Eric Raymond的說法,處理BLOB的主要思想就是讓檔案處理器(
Time of Update: 2015-06-23
標籤:在MySQL資料庫中的mysql.user表中使用insert語句添加新使用者時,可能會出現以下錯誤:ERROR 1364 (HY000): Field ‘ssl_cipher‘ doesn‘t have a default value原因是在my.ini設定檔中有這樣一條語句sql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ES 指定了strict 模式,為了安全,strict 模式禁止通過insert
Time of Update: 2015-06-23
標籤:查看資料庫->show databases;建資料庫->create database 資料庫名;建表->use 資料庫名;->create table 表名(欄位);查看所有表->show tables;查看錶資訊->desc 表名;刪除表->drop database 資料庫名; 1 mysql> show databases; 2 +--------------------+ 3 | Database | 4 +--
Time of Update: 2015-06-23
標籤:MySQL的遠端連線有3個步驟:1、為遠端存取的主機賦予許可權:1 GRANT ALL PRIVILEGES ON yourdatabasename.* TO [email protected]‘romote access IP‘ IDENTIFIED BY ‘password‘ WITH GRANT OPTION;為了使我們的修改生效,接著要輸入命令:flush
Time of Update: 2015-06-23
標籤:在hibernate.cfg.xml設定檔中,增加以下內容:<property name="hibernate.connection.provider_class">org.hibernate.connection.C3P0ConnectionProvider</property> <property name="hibernate.c3p0.max_size">20</property> <!--
Time of Update: 2015-06-23
標籤:原文: Mysql主鍵索引、唯一索引、普通索引、全文索引、複合式索引的區別
Time of Update: 2015-06-23
CentOS的MySQL報錯:Can't connect to MySQL server on 'XXX' (13)環境:系統版本:CentOS release 6.5 (Final)資料庫版本:5.1.73問題描述:使用用戶端遠程登入串連基於CentOS 6.5伺服器上的Mysql,報錯:Can't connect to MySQL server on 'XXX' (13)解決方案:通常情況下,可以進行如下設定1. 進入MySQL的控制台# mysql -u root